1. Introducción
The Fujifilm EF-20 is a compact shoe mount flash designed to provide additional illumination for your photography. It features TTL (Through-The-Lens) flash technology for precise exposure control, multi-directional bounce capabilities, and automatic zooming. This manual provides essential information for the safe and effective use of your EF-20 flash unit.

4. Configuración
4.1 Instalación de la batería
- Abra la tapa del compartimiento de la batería ubicada en el costado de la unidad de flash.
- Inserte dos (2) baterías AA, asegurándose de la polaridad correcta (+/-) como se indica dentro del compartimiento.
- Cierre bien la tapa del compartimento de la batería.

Figura 2: Posterior view of the EF-20 flash unit, illustrating the location of the battery compartment and control panel.
4.2 Montaje de la unidad de flash
- Asegúrese de que tanto la cámara como la unidad de flash estén apagadas.
- Slide the flash unit's mounting foot into the camera's hot shoe until it clicks into place.
- Tighten the locking wheel on the flash unit's foot to secure it firmly to the camera.
- To remove, loosen the locking wheel and slide the flash unit out of the hot shoe.

5. Instrucciones de funcionamiento
5.1 Encendido / Apagado
Presione el FUERZA button on the rear of the flash unit to turn it on or off. The ready lamp will illuminate when the flash is charged and ready to fire.
5.2 TTL Flash Technology
The EF-20 utilizes High Precision TTL (Through-The-Lens) flash technology. When mounted on a compatible Fujifilm camera, the flash output is automatically adjusted based on the camera's metering system to achieve optimal exposure.
5.3 Exposure Compensation (EV Adjust)
To adjust the flash exposure compensation, press the EV ADJUST button on the rear of the flash. Each press cycles through available compensation values (-1, -0.5, 0, +0.5, +1 EV). The corresponding indicator lamp will light up. This allows for fine-tuning the flash output relative to the camera's automatic setting.
5.4 Bounce Flash (Multi-Directional)
The flash head can be tilted upwards to bounce light off a ceiling or wall, creating softer, more natural illumination and reducing harsh shadows. The EF-20 features a multi-directional tilting head.

Figura 4: Lado view of the EF-20 flash demonstrating the upward tilt capability of the flash head for bounce photography.
5.5 Automatic Zooming
The EF-20 features automatic zooming, which adjusts the flash coverage to match the focal length of the lens being used, ensuring efficient light distribution.
5.6 Full Manual Control
In addition to TTL, the flash offers full manual control options, allowing users to set the flash output power directly for specific creative effects or challenging lighting conditions. Refer to your camera's manual for specific settings related to external flash control.
5.7 Test/Ready Button
El TEST/READY El botón cumple dos funciones:
- When the flash is charged, pressing this button will fire a test flash.
- El lamp next to this button indicates when the flash is fully charged and ready to fire.

5.8 Cámaras compatibles
The Fujifilm EF-20 flash is compatible with various Fujifilm cameras, including but not limited to:
- X10, X100, X100S
- HS20EXR, HS22EXR, HS25EXR, HS28EXR, HS30EXR, HS33EXR
- S30EXR, S33EXR
- SL240, SL260, SL280, SL300, SL305
For the most current compatibility list, please refer to the official Fujifilm website or your camera's instruction manual.
6. Mantenimiento
- Limpieza: Utilice un paño suave y seco para limpiar la unidad de flash. Para la suciedad difícil, frote ligeramente.ampen the cloth with water and then wipe dry. Do not use organic solvents like alcohol or paint thinner.
- Cuidado de la batería: Always remove batteries when the flash is not in use for extended periods to prevent leakage. Dispose of used batteries according to local regulations.
- Almacenamiento: Guarde la unidad de flash en un lugar fresco y seco, alejado de la luz solar directa y de temperaturas extremas.

8. Especificaciones
| Número de modelo | EF-20 |
| Número de guía | 20 (at ISO 100) |
| Tipo de flash | Shoe Mount, External |
| Flash Control | TTL, Manual |
| Fuente de poder | 2 pilas AA |
| Duración de la batería | Aproximadamente 6 horas (dependiendo del uso) |
| Velocidad de sincronización del flash | 1/180 or 1/250 (camera dependent) |
| Dimensiones (An x Al x Pr) | 1.8 x 5.8 x 4.1 pulgadas (aproximadamente) |
| Peso | 3.52 onzas (sin pilas) |
| Primero disponible | 8 de febrero de 2011 |
